"The Song of the Lark" Not Good For Much Except Putting You To Sleep
I read Cathers' "O Pioneers," which I enjoyed, and then "One of Ours," which I thought was one of the best books on World War I that I've ever read. But "The Song of the Lark" was a disappointment. The tale of a young woman from Colorado and her quest to become an opera singer at the turn of the 20th Century just did nothing for me. It was, in a word, dull. While some of the writing is good, the plot just drags. I don't recommend it except as a cure for insomnia.

Absorbing story of the evolution of an artist
Through the artful recounting of the important relationships and experiences that permitted a young girl from a small town in the American West to evolve into a great opera singer, the reader is transported to another time and place through lyrical language and a timeless account of the rewards of grit and determination .
